Article 370 essential until J&K’s final resolution: Farooq

National Conference president and Member of Parliament Dr Farooq Abdullah on Saturday said annulling Articles 370 and 35-A will tantamount to a constitutional coup.

Addressing a workers convention here in north Kashmir DrFarooq said, “Article 370 is essential and unassailable until the finalresolution of the state is reached to.”

The NC president said, “Not even a single day passes, whenwe don’t hear our enemies cry about the temporality of the Art 370. Yes, theArt was deemed to be temporary unless the issue of the state was not resolved.However, the issue is still lingering around; therefore the Article 370 willcontinue to remain around. The accession of the state took place in unusualcircumstances. The Maharaja who was rather vacillating then did not want toaccede to any of the two dominions. He wanted the erstwhile state to remainfree.  However that didn’t happen, he hadto make a choice in extra ordinary circumstances. Keeping in view the specialcircumstances, Article 370 was added to the constitution of India. The Art willremain as it is until the final resolution of the issue of Jammu and Kashmir isnot reached to. That resolution hasn’t been reached yet. So until the issue issolved, no power on earth can touch the Article 370. The uneducated rants ofthose who want to obliterate Art 370 are far-fetched, fanciful and devoid ofany genuineness,” he said adding, “We are fighting for our rights. Our struggleis based on principles. We are seeking our rights. It is people of the statefrom whom we draw our energy, and we will continue with our mission.”

Referring to Art 35-A Dr Farooq said that the Art 35-A was the fall out of the Art 370 andfiddling with it will upset all the successive amendments to the presidentialof 1954. “If Art 35-A is annulled, then all the successive presidential orderswill get annulled automatically. It was the then Maharaja who gave the statesubject rights to the people of state in 1927,” he said adding, “it is theprime duty of the NC workers, functionaries to apprise the people living intowns and villages about the impending threats on our special position.  The need of the hour calls for making peoplealert about the consequences of repealing Art 370, Art 35-A.”
